Sodium alginate is commonly used in the food industry as a thickening, stabilizing, and gelling agent. It is also used in the pharmaceutical and cosmetic industries for its emulsifying and binding properties. In addition, sodium alginate is used in textile printing and as a sculpture medium in art and crafts.

Alginate is a natural polysaccharide derived from brown seaweed. It is composed of guluronic and mannuronic acid monomers linked together to form a gel-like structure. Alginate is commonly used in food and pharmaceutical industries for its gelling, thickening, and stabilizing properties.

In spatulating alginate material, a spatula is used to mix the alginate powder with water in a clean mixing bowl. The spatula is then used to stir and mix the material until a smooth and consistent mixture is achieved, free of any lumps or air bubbles.
Sodium alginate was approved by the FDA as a food additive in 1972. It is used primarily as a thickening agent, emulsifier, and stabilizer in various food products. Additionally, sodium alginate is recognized for its applications in pharmaceuticals and other industries due to its biocompatibility and gelling properties.

Sodium alginate beads are formed through a process called gelation, where sodium alginate solution is dripped or squirted into a bath of calcium chloride. The calcium ions in the calcium chloride cause the sodium alginate to crosslink and form solid beads. These beads can then be rinsed and used for various applications in food, pharmaceuticals, and other industries.
